Here's a quick look at VA streamline refinance closing costs you can expect to … WebThe VA will only allow a VA loan to fund up to the value of the house being bought, plus the VA funding fee. So, if home value is $100k, and funding fee is $3k, then the loan can max out at $103k. The only way to roll your closing costs into the loan is to get the loan value + closing costs to be equal to or less than the value of the home.
